Design and Operation

Centrifugal pumps operate by converting rotational energy from a motor into kinetic energy in the fluid being pumped. This kinetic energy is then converted into pressure energy as the fluid exits the pump through the discharge outlet. The key components of a centrifugal pump include the impeller, casing, and shaft. The impeller is responsible for imparting velocity to the fluid, while the casing directs the flow and increases the pressure of the fluid.

Performance Analysis

The performance of a centrifugal pump is typically evaluated based on factors such as flow rate, head, efficiency, and power consumption. The pump curve, which plots the relationship between flow rate and head, is a critical tool for analyzing the performance of a centrifugal pump. By examining the pump curve, engineers can determine the operating point of the pump and optimize its performance for a given application.

Applications

Centrifugal pumps find wide-ranging applications in various industries, including oil and gas, water treatment, chemical processing, and HVAC systems. These pumps are suitable for transferring liquids with low viscosity and are ideal for applications requiring high flow rates and moderate to high pressures. Centrifugal pumps are also commonly used in irrigation systems, fire protection systems, and wastewater treatment plants.
